Tulsi Gabbard was born April 12 in 1981. She is an American politician and United States Army Reserve officer. Gabbard was the first Hindu member of Congress and was also the first American Samoan to vote of Congress. She ran for the Democratic nomination for the 2020 United States presidential election,[2][3] prior to quitting the party and becoming an independent candidate in October 2022. In 2002, Gabbard was elected to the Hawaii House of Representatives at the age of 21. 4 Gabbard was a member of the Hawaii Army National Guard's field medical unit. She was deployed to Iraq during 2004-2005. Between 2005 and 2006, she was stationed in Kuwait as an Army Military Police platoon commander. As she was a member of Congress Gabbard was a vice chair of the Democratic National Committee (DNC) from 2013 to 2016. She resigned in order to support Bernie Sanders' campaign for the 2016 Democratic nomination for president.
